Sharing of daily maintenance skills for bag filter operation and maintenance

As the core equipment for industrial dust treatment, the operational stability of bag filter is directly related to the environmental quality and environmental compliance of the production workshop. For overseas enterprises, scientific operation and daily maintenance can not only extend the service life of equipment, but also avoid production losses caused by downtime due to malfunctions. Below are practical tips that are tailored to actual working conditions, including maintenance of core components, operation monitoring, and prevention of common problems.

1、 Core component maintenance: Fine maintenance of filter bags

The filter bag is the filtering core of the bag filter, and its state directly determines the dust removal efficiency. Daily maintenance should focus on the following points. Firstly, regular inspections are recommended. It is suggested to observe the surface condition of the filter bag through the equipment maintenance door every week. If any damage, detachment, sticking or hardening of the filter bag is found, it should be dealt with in a timely manner. For industries with high hygiene requirements such as food and pharmaceuticals, damaged filter bags need to be replaced immediately to avoid dust leakage and product contamination.

The cleaning and maintenance of filter bags should be adjusted according to the characteristics of dust. For dry dust with low viscosity, filter bag wear can be reduced by optimizing cleaning parameters; If the dust is highly viscous and prone to clumping, it is necessary to regularly check whether the dust cleaning system is unobstructed. If necessary, a low-pressure pulse dust cleaning mode should be used to avoid the impact of high-pressure airflow on the filter bag. In addition, the replacement of filter bags should follow the principle of "synchronous replacement of the same batch" to ensure consistent filtration resistance of filter bags and avoid uneven overall equipment load caused by aging of some filter bags.

The storage and replacement details of filter bags cannot be ignored. The spare filter bag should be stored in a dry and ventilated environment to avoid moisture and mold growth of the filter material; When replacing, attention should be paid to the sealing fit between the filter bag and the flower board to prevent dust from escaping through the gaps, and to avoid scratching the surface of the filter bag with sharp tools, thereby extending its service life.

2、 Ash cleaning system: key to ensuring stable operation

Dust cleaning system failure is a common cause of decreased efficiency in bag filters, and daily maintenance should take into account both mechanical components and control parameters. As the core component of the dust cleaning system, the pulse valve needs to be checked daily for its working status. If any leakage, weak blowing or stuck valve core is found in the pulse valve, it should be disassembled and repaired in a timely manner, and damaged sealing rings or valve cores should be replaced. For high-frequency operating conditions, it is recommended to thoroughly clean the pulse valve once a month to remove dust and dirt from the valve body.

The maintenance of spray pipes and nozzles should pay attention to smoothness. Check the spray pipe weekly for any deformation or displacement, ensure that the nozzle is aligned with the center of the filter bag, and avoid local wear of the filter bag caused by the displacement of the spray airflow; Every month, use compressed air to blow and clean the inside of the spray pipe, remove residual dust and impurities, and prevent nozzle blockage from affecting the cleaning effect. For high-temperature working conditions, it is necessary to regularly check the high-temperature resistance of the spray pipe. If corrosion or deformation occurs, it should be replaced in a timely manner to avoid safety hazards.

The dynamic adjustment of dust cleaning parameters is also a key maintenance focus. Optimize the cleaning cycle and blowing time in a timely manner based on changes in dust concentration. For example, during peak production seasons when dust concentration increases, the cleaning cycle can be appropriately shortened, but excessive cleaning should be avoided to prevent damage to the fiber structure of the filter bag; Before shutting down the equipment, a thorough dust cleaning should be carried out to remove dust from the surface of the filter bag and prevent dust from clumping and adhering to the filter bag during shutdown.

3、 Equipment body and auxiliary system: basic maintenance cannot be ignored

The maintenance of the bag filter body and auxiliary system is the foundation for ensuring the long-term stable operation of the equipment. The maintenance of the equipment casing should pay attention to its sealing and anti-corrosion properties. The sealing gasket at the connection of the casing should be checked weekly for aging and damage. If there is any air leakage, the sealing material should be replaced in a timely manner; For the working conditions of handling corrosive gases, it is necessary to check the anti-corrosion coating inside the shell every month. If the coating falls off, it should be promptly repaired to prevent the shell from being corroded and perforated.

The maintenance focus of ash hopper and ash unloading device is to prevent blockage. Check the accuracy of the ash hopper level gauge daily to avoid excessive ash accumulation in the hopper due to gauge malfunction; The ash discharge valve needs to be checked for operation status every week. If there is jamming or abnormal noise, it should be stopped and cleaned in a timely manner to avoid motor overload damage. In humid or prone to clumping dust conditions, a heat tracing device can be installed on the outside of the ash hopper, and the heat tracing temperature should be regularly checked to prevent dust from getting damp and clumping, blocking the ash discharge channel.

The maintenance of fans and motors should follow the general industrial equipment standards. Check the lubrication condition of the fan bearings every month, replenish or replace lubricating oil in a timely manner, and ensure smooth operation of the bearings; Regularly clean the dust and dirt on the fan impeller to avoid the imbalance of the impeller and the exacerbation of equipment vibration. The motor part needs to be well protected against moisture and dust, and the wiring terminals should be checked for firmness to avoid electrical faults caused by poor contact. Especially in humid and hot overseas environments, it is necessary to strengthen the ventilation and heat dissipation of the motor.

4、 Operation monitoring and exception handling: preventing fault risks in advance

Establishing a comprehensive operation monitoring mechanism in daily maintenance can effectively detect equipment abnormalities in advance. It is recommended to monitor the core parameters such as inlet and outlet pressure difference, air volume, and temperature of the equipment in real time. If a sudden increase in inlet and outlet pressure difference is found, it may be caused by filter bag blockage or ash accumulation in the ash hopper. It is necessary to check the ash cleaning system and ash unloading device in a timely manner; If the pressure difference suddenly decreases, it is necessary to check whether the filter bag is damaged or the seal has failed.

To address the issue of insufficient professionalism in the operation and maintenance team that overseas enterprises may face, the daily inspection process can be simplified, and a multilingual "fault diagnosis comparison table" can be created to clarify the possible causes and handling methods corresponding to parameter abnormalities. For example, when the dust concentration at the equipment discharge outlet exceeds the standard, the problem can be gradually identified in the order of "filter bag damage → seal failure → insufficient dust cleaning" to quickly locate the problem.

Regular shutdown and maintenance of equipment are indispensable. It is recommended to conduct a comprehensive shutdown inspection every quarter, focusing on checking the wear condition of the filter bag, the performance of the cleaning system, the anti-corrosion coating of the shell, etc. At the same time, the electrical control system should be calibrated to ensure that all sensors and actuators are working properly. During overseas holidays or off-season production, annual major repairs can be arranged to centrally replace aging components, laying the foundation for stable operation in the future.

5、 Maintenance Summary: Establish a normalized mechanism

The core of operation and maintenance of bag filters lies in "prevention first, refined management". Overseas enterprises can develop personalized maintenance schedules based on local operating conditions and equipment usage frequency, clarifying daily, weekly, and monthly maintenance items and responsible persons, forming a closed-loop mechanism of "inspection record processing feedback". At the same time, pay attention to the training of operators to ensure that they master basic maintenance skills and abnormal judgment abilities, and reduce equipment failures caused by improper operation.

Scientific daily maintenance not only ensures the efficient operation of bag filters and meets the environmental standards of the target market, but also reduces equipment failure rates and maintenance costs, providing reliable guarantees for the production continuity of overseas enterprises. This is also the key to the long-term environmental protection value of bag filters.
